ROLE OVERVIEW
This role focuses on coordinating and progressing remediation programmes, including:
Projects funded through the Building Safety Fund or Cladding Safety Scheme, and Developer-led remediation projects delivered under the terms of a Developer Remediation Contract (DRC).
You will act as the central point of coordination, managing remediation applications, consultant inputs and stakeholder communication, rather than providing technical fire safety or health & safety expertise.

HOW YOU’LL SPEND MOST OF YOUR TIME
Most weeks, you’ll be:
*Coordinating remediation and major works programmes, including façade and fire safety works
*Managing and supporting BSF / CSS applications and developer remediation activity
*Liaising with surveyors, engineers, cost consultants and funding agents
*Communicating regularly with clients, leaseholders and residents on remediation progress
*Conducting site visits and progress reviews as required
*Producing clear updates, reports and written communications for stakeholders
